Peat bogs are wetland areas characterized by the accumulation of partially decayed organic material called peat. These ecosystems are found in many parts of the world and have played a significant role in history and ecology. They preserve biological material and provide insights into past climates and human activity.
Formation and Characteristics of Peat Bogs
Peat bogs form in areas with high rainfall and poor drainage, which slows decomposition. Over thousands of years, plant material such as mosses, grasses, and trees accumulates, creating thick layers of peat. These environments are acidic and low in oxygen, which helps preserve organic matter.
Historical Significance of Peat Bogs
Peat bogs have preserved numerous archaeological artifacts, including wooden tools, textiles, and even human remains. These discoveries provide valuable insights into ancient cultures and their ways of life. The preservation is due to the anaerobic conditions that prevent decay.
Environmental and Cultural Importance
Today, peat bogs are recognized for their ecological importance, supporting unique plant and animal species. They also act as carbon sinks, helping to regulate climate change. In some regions, peat extraction has historical roots, but conservation efforts aim to protect these vital ecosystems.
